the cloth required for making a dress is 23/5m. find the length of cloth for making 20 such dress. if a person buys 100 m cloth. how much cloth will be left after making 20 dresses​

Answer:

92 m cloth is required and 8m is remaining.

Step-by-step explanation:

Length of cloth required for making a dress = 23/5 m.

Length if cloth required for making 20 dresses = 23/5*20 = 92m.

A person purchased 100m cloth so, remaining cloth = 100-92 m

= 8m

Therefore, 92 m of cloth is required and 8 m is remaining...
